What is universal design?
All design is problem solving. Universal design is a protocol where we create interior design solutions that are inherently accessible to everyone, including people of all ages and abilities.
What are some of the features?
Barrier-Free space planning to accommodate mobility devices, comprehensive lighting plans for the vision impaired, Lever handles for opening doors, light switches with large flat panels, kitchen counters at several heights to accommodate different postures.
Can universal design look good?
With experience, universal design can be seamlessly integrated into a beautiful, functional and cost effective space.
